Output 6333015e2e12fb301025912c213a23af1cb48a168e18659ce94c218d25b3a748:4

value
22217547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29ab97030f86ed43c95a647036cfad0192a6f501 OP_EQUAL
address
35VMBgbDRAis76ULnQNL5bF42tXgPGhtuc
transaction
6333015e2e12fb301025912c213a23af1cb48a168e18659ce94c218d25b3a748
confirmations
338546
spent
true